The Best Sports Dynasties: New England Patriots vs. Golden State Warriors

Introduction

Sports dynasties are teams that dominate their respective sport for an extended period. These teams enjoy consistent success season after season, have a plethora of championships, and are often considered the best in their sport. Two of the most prominent sports dynasties of the past decade are the New England Patriots and the Golden State Warriors. While both teams dominate their respective sports, several differences set them apart.

Team Success

The New England Patriots are one of the most successful football franchises in NFL history. Since 2001, the Patriots have appeared in nine Super Bowls, winning six of them, all with legendary quarterback Tom Brady. On the other hand, the Golden State Warriors are an elite NBA team known for their flashy offensive style and unstoppable three-point-shooting. The Warriors have appeared in five consecutive NBA Finals, winning three in four years (2015, 2017, 2018).

Key Players

Without question, the most significant determinant of success for any sports dynasty is the caliber of its key players. For the New England Patriots, their immense success was largely fueled by the legendary quarterback Tom Brady. Brady, who led the team to six Super Bowl wins, is widely considered the greatest quarterback of all time. Meanwhile, the Golden State Warriors have relied heavily on the scoring prowess of point guard Stephen Curry, the two-time NBA Most Valuable Player (MVP). Curry is known for his incredible three-point shooting accuracy and ability to create space on the court.

Coaching and Management

Strong leadership is essential for maintaining any dynasty. The Patriots are led by coach Bill Belichick, who has won five Super Bowls with the team. Belichick is known for his innovative strategies, ability to identify and develop talent, and his relentless focus on details. The Golden State Warriors, on the other hand, have a similarly successful coach in Steve Kerr. Kerr has won three NBA championships with the team and has been instrumental in the team’s success, particularly with his emphasis on teamwork and creating a fun atmosphere.

Style of Play

While both the Patriots and Warriors are known for their supremacy in their respective sports, they play very differently. The Patriots are known for their methodical, disciplined, and well-executed plays, while the Warriors are known for their flashy, high-scoring, and fast-paced style. Both teams have attained their success through a combination of skill and efficiency, but their approaches differ significantly.
